View Technical SpecsOptical network engineering is undergoing a critical transition. While 100G QSFP28 optical modules remain the cornerstone of enterprise local networks, hyperscalers, telecommunication service providers, and modern industrial hubs are scaling rapidly towards 200G (QSFP56) and 400G (QSFP-DD) to prevent bottlenecking.
| Form Factor | Modulation Technology | Typical Port Count Density | Antwerp Industry Applications | Energy Consumption Profile |
|---|---|---|---|---|
| 100G QSFP28 | NRZ (Non-Return-to-Zero) | High (up to 36 ports per RU) | Enterprise backplanes, automated port logistics | Lowest (typically < 3.5W per module) |
| 200G QSFP56 | PAM4 (Pulse Amplitude Modulation 4-Level) | Medium-High | Colocation infrastructure, regional ISPs | Moderate (typically < 5.5W per module) |
| 400G QSFP-DD | PAM4 / Coherent Optical Detection | High (double-density structure) | High Performance AI clusters, DCI backbones | Managed (typically < 12W per module) |
As network bandwidth requirements compound yearly, the integration of Silicon Photonics (SiPh) and Co-Packaged Optics (CPO) is transforming design frameworks. Silicon photonics integrates optical circuits directly onto silicon chips, minimizing insertion losses, maximizing thermal dissipation efficiency, and decreasing production costs. For Antwerp enterprises configuring long-distance metropolitan networks, these architectures ensure consistent data transfer without jitter or high error rates.
